Dominic Thiem won a match of a high level and very great physical intensity against Rafael Nadal 7-6 (9/7), 7-6 (7/4), Tuesday at the London Masters, making a great not towards the semi-finals.

Thiem (3rd in the world) thus won his second victory in as many matches in the London 2020 group after beating Stefanos Tsitsipas (6th) on Sunday.

The 27-year-old Austrian, finalist in London last year and winner in 2020 of his first Grand Slam tournament at the US Open, will be sure to play in the semi-finals if Tsitsipas beats Andrey Rublev (8th) in the evening.

For Nadal (2nd), on the other hand, the task is complicated and everything will be decided Thursday at the end of the last day of the group stage for the London 2020 group, during which he will face Tsitsipas.

Thiem saved two set points in the tie-break of the first set before putting up three consecutive runs and pocketing the set.

In the second set, the Austrian offered himself three match points at 5-4 and 40-0 on Nadal's serve, but the Spaniard chained five consecutive points to return to 5-5.

The two players reached the decisive game again, during which Thiem broke off 6-3 and offered himself three more match points.

He concluded on the second.
